New Experienced Footballer Joining Spartak Trnava’s Attack: Coach Reveals Future New Member with Pre-Printed Jersey Tag

Another experienced footballer will join Spartak Trnava’s attack, who should help the “black and red” improve their offensive and bring the necessary goals. Coach Michal Gašparík revealed that the future new member of his cabin already has a printed jersey with a name tag.

Soccer players Spartak Trnava are currently in the winter tournament Tipsport Malta Cup 2024, during which they undergo a two-week training before the start of the spring part of the Nike League. They will compete against a pair of Czech clubs Sigma Olomouc a Hradec Králové and Austria is also waiting for them Austria Vienna.

The Spartak team is trying to fine-tune their form as best as possible on the popular holiday island, and two new players should help Trnava to do this – a 22-year-old Swede Jaheem Burke and an equally old Croat Tomislav Krizmanič.

“They are a bit tired and you can feel it. And they say so themselves,” Gašparík laughed, “even though we started a bit lightly, but they were used to something else and you can feel that they are tired and have heavier legs, but we know why we took them. They both have quality, they are young guys, so I believe that they will gradually get into it even more.”

“I believe that they will succeed in this competition as well, because the team is of high quality, we have doubled positions, so it will not be easy for them, but they are promising players. I believe they will be helpful in the spring, but also in the future. It is difficult to predict in advance. It will be best to see their development in the team, but I think they have a perspective,” added the coach of Spartak.

One veteran has gone, another is coming

In the near future, another new player should join the “little Rome” who should fill the vacant post in the leading position, where the experienced Michal Ďuriš worked successfully during the fall. “He hasn’t joined us yet, but his jersey is already made,” smiled Michal Gašparík. “We are waiting to see if he agrees with the club and maybe he will be here today or tomorrow and maybe he won’t come. We don’t have any details yet, so we’ll see what happens.” said Gašparík on Tuesday.

According to information from ŠPORT.sk, a 35-year-old Czech forward should become a new player for Spartak Trnava Tomas Poznar, who last worked in the Polish club Termalica Nieczieczia. In his portfolio he has several Czech clubs such as Zlín, Viktoria Plzeň and Baník Ostrava, but in the 2013/14 season he also worked in Slovakia, where he wore the jersey of Spartak Trnava.

He scored 3 goals in 11 matches at that time. He scored the most for his “native” Zlín, in whose colors he played 260 matches, scored 79 goals and assisted on 17. However, he has been without an employer since January.

As part of the Tipsport Malta Cup tournament, Trnava’s first match awaits already on Wednesday evening, when it will meet Sigma Olomouc at 20:00 at the Ta’Qali National Stadium.
